Was given a twin room on 6th floor when checked in. Found the room to be stuffy & realised its only window is the fixed type that cannot be opened. Was told by reception that it’s for security reason. I asked for room change & was given one on 1st floor. It’s smaller and it’s very noisy due heavy traffic on the road in front & also noise from smokers gathered on the pedestrian path. Notified reception that a bulb in the toilet was blown on the 3rd & 4th mornings, it was not replaced. We stayed for 5 nights. Breakfast was very good but it’s menu is the same every day. Good location. Sandwiched between Earls Court & Gloucester Road Tube stations, 400-500m away. Sainsbury & Waitrose supermarkets close by also. Microwave available at dining hall to heat up food in the evening. Good housekeeping & wifi.
